I have a GUI app in PyQt5 that create display items with checkboxes in a QlistWidget where the user check on the item and the system print the checked values.
The problem is that when the user check the items it display the below error:
print([i.text() for i in self.checked])
AttributeError: 'str' object has no attribute 'text'
But this line print([i.text() for i in self.checked])
print the values only in the print
this line is the error :
self.checked = [i.text() for i in self.checked]

The problem is trivial, it is assumed that in the variable "checked" you want to save the QListWidgetItem that have been checked. Let's analyze what happens with an example: let's say that the user selects the first option, then "checked" will be empty initially so the checked item is compared and added to the list but later checked is a list of the texts of the QListWidgetItem , which denatures the logic. So as a lesson don't use the same variable for multiple things:
def selectionChanged(self, item):
if item.checkState():
if item not in self.checked:
self.checked.append(item)
elif item in self.checked:
self.checked.remove(item)
values = [i.text() for i in self.checked]
print(values)
